WebAs with any form of art and writing, ultimately, an avenue is created for you to express yourself. To say that poetry and spoken word are equal is like stating that sculpting and painting are identical. Though they serve a similar purpose, the way they accomplish creative goals is totally unique. In a venn diagram, “contemporary poetry” is a big circle, and “spoken word” is a circle that overlaps it. There is “spoken word” that is not intended as poetry, and there is a grea...

WebThere is a distinction, not a difference. Poetry can be spoken or written. The spoken word may or may not be poetic.
